         Scottie Vaccaro          12/CF          10th Season
HIGHLIGHTS:

- Co-founded the Paterson Black Sox in the Fall of 2003.
- Won Manager of the Year honors in 2003, after leading the team to an 8-2 record and a championship.
- Named Roy Campanella Fall League All-Star Team manager for 2003.
- Named Tommie Agee Summer League All-Star Team manager for 2004.
- Awarded Golden Glove honors in 2005.
- Selected to the 2002 Tommie Agee League All-Star team as the team's starting centerfielder.
- Managed 2006 Spring team to a Championship Finals appearance after finishing the season 14-6.
Scottie Vaccaro is known for his skill in centerfield, with the ability to cover a lot of ground with a strong throwing arm.  Started as an average hitter at the plate with terrific speed, has now become an excellent on-base player and is still always a threat to steal bases.
